site.btaDay-ahead Electricity Price Down by 24% on Wednesday
Electricity was traded for an average price of EUR 92.55 (excluding VAT) per megawatt-hour on Tuesday on the Bulgarian Independent Energy Exchange (IBEX) in the Day-Ahead market segment. Transactions are based on delivery for the following day, March 18.
The energy exchange closed on Tuesday at an average price of EUR 121.31 per megawatt-hour. This means that electricity for Bulgarian businesses tomorrow will be 23.71% cheaper compared to Tuesday’s price.
The average price of peak energy (09:00–20:00) for tomorrow is EUR 72.79 per megawatt-hour, while off-peak energy (01:00–08:00; 21:00–24:00) was traded at an average of EUR 112.30 per megawatt-hour.
IBEX data show that a total of 103,897.55 megawatt-hours of electricity were sold.
In the Intraday market segment, the weighted average price for 60-minute products is currently EUR 95.45 (excluding VAT) per megawatt-hour.
For 15-minute products, the weighted daily average price at this time is EUR 97.61 (excluding VAT) per megawatt-hour.
